What we're looking for: We're on the hunt for an experienced and highly skilled Industrial Designer with a strong background in both 2D and 3D stand designs and a proven track record in the trade show industry. The ideal candidate will possess a unique blend of creativity, technical expertise, and practical experience, enabling them to conceptualize and execute captivating and effective stand designs that meet our clients' objectives and exceed their expectations. If you are a talented designer with a passion for transforming spaces and creating immersive experiences, we invite you to join our team!

To Succeed in This Role, You Need To:

Concept Development: Collaborate with the creative team, including art directors, strategists, and account managers, to develop innovative and functional 2D and 3D stand designs for trade shows, exhibitions, and events that align with client objectives and branding guidelines. Design and Visualization: Create detailed design sketches, renderings, and technical drawings using industry-standard software, such as AutoCAD, SketchUp, Rhino, or 3ds Max, to effectively communicate design concepts and facilitate client approvals. Materials and Manufacturing: Research and select appropriate materials, finishes, and construction techniques for each project, considering factors such as aesthetics, durability, cost, sustainability, and manufacturing processes. Project Management: Manage multiple design projects simultaneously, ensuring that all deliverables are completed on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ards. Client Communication: Present design concepts and progress updates to clients, addressing their feedback and concerns while maintaining a professional and solution-oriented approach. Vendor Coordination: Liaise with fabricators, suppliers, and other external partners to ensure that designs are executed accurately and efficiently, and that all project specifications and deadlines are met. Technical Documentation: Prepare comprehensive technical documentation, including assembly instructions, bill of materials, and specifications, to support the manufacturing, installation, and maintenance of stand designs. Quality Control: Conduct thorough quality checks on all design work and oversee the production process to ensure that the final output meets the agency's high standards and adheres to client requirements. Team Collaboration: Actively participate in team meetings and brainstorming sessions, sharing your expertise in 2D and 3D stand design and providing constructive feedback to foster a culture of continuous improvement and creative excellence. Continuous Learning: Stay current with industry trends, emerging technologies, and best practices in industrial design and the trade show industry, continually expanding your skillset and ensuring that the agency remains at the forefront of design innovation.
